Acute Promyelocytic Leukemia (APL)
 +
 
 +
(90% to 95%) of the cases, APL results from a t (15;17) (q22;q21) translocation resulting in the head to tail fusion of the promyelocytic leukemia (PML) gene, to RAR-alpha to generate two fusion genes, PML-RARalpha and a reciprocal RAR-alpha-PML (80%) that encode a protein, which functions as an aberrant retinoid receptor [3].
